首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Excel公式,用于检查字符串中是否存在关键字,然后将该关键字与另一个单词进行匹配

Excel公式可以使用以下函数来检查字符串中是否存在关键字,并将该关键字与另一个单词进行匹配:

  1. FIND函数:用于查找一个字符串在另一个字符串中的位置。可以结合IF函数使用,判断关键字是否存在。
    • 概念:FIND函数返回一个字符串在另一个字符串中的位置,如果找不到,则返回错误值#VALUE。
    • 分类:FIND函数属于文本函数。
    • 优势:可以快速定位字符串中关键字的位置。
    • 应用场景:可以用于搜索和匹配特定关键字。
    • 腾讯云相关产品:无
  • IF函数:用于根据条件判断返回不同的值。
    • 概念:IF函数根据指定的条件判断,如果条件为真,则返回一个值;如果条件为假,则返回另一个值。
    • 分类:IF函数属于逻辑函数。
    • 优势:可以根据条件灵活地返回不同的结果。
    • 应用场景:可以用于根据关键字是否存在进行条件判断。
    • 腾讯云相关产品:无
  • CONCATENATE函数:用于将多个字符串合并为一个字符串。
    • 概念:CONCATENATE函数将多个字符串合并为一个字符串。
    • 分类:CONCATENATE函数属于文本函数。
    • 优势:可以将多个字符串拼接为一个字符串。
    • 应用场景:可以用于将关键字与另一个单词进行匹配。
    • 腾讯云相关产品:无

综上所述,可以使用FIND函数结合IF函数和CONCATENATE函数来检查字符串中是否存在关键字,并将该关键字与另一个单词进行匹配。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

通宵翻译Pandas官方文档,写了这份Excel万字肝货操作!

pandas 可以创建 Excel 文件、CSV 或许多其他格式。 数据操作 1. 列操作 在电子表格公式通常在单个单元格创建,然后拖入其他单元格以计算其他列的公式。...在Excel电子表格,可以使用条件公式进行逻辑比较。我们将使用 =IF(A2 < 10, "low", "high")的公式,将其拖到新存储列的所有单元格。...按位置提取子串 电子表格有一个 MID 公式用于从给定位置提取子字符串。获取第一个字符: =MID(A2,1,1) 使用 Pandas,您可以使用 [] 表示法按位置位置从字符串中提取子字符串。...提取第n个单词Excel ,您可以使用文本到列向导来拆分文本和检索特定列。(请注意,也可以通过公式来做到这一点。)...在 Pandas 中提取单词最简单的方法是用空格分割字符串然后按索引引用单词。请注意,如果您需要,还有更强大的方法。

19.5K20

简单的Excel VBA编程问题解答——完美Excel第183周小结

如果在所有Case语句都不匹配的情况下没有要执行的代码,则可以省略Else部分。 8.IIf函数有什么作用? IIf函数评估条件,如果为True,则返回一个值;如果为False,则返回另一个值。...12.Function过程Sub过程有何不同? Function过程会向程序返回一个值,而Sub过程则不会。 13.过程的代码行数有什么限制?...在VBA代码,如何表明该值是日期? 通过将其括在#字符。 18.哪个VBA函数用于为日期添加间隔? DateAdd函数。 19.哪两个函数用于搜索文本(在另一个字符串查找一个字符串)?...20.如何转换字符串,以使每个单词的首字母大写,而所有其他字母小写? 使用vbProperCase参数调用StrConv函数。 21.字符“A”和“a”是否具有相同的ASCII值? 不是。...欢迎到知识星球:完美Excel社群,进行技术交流和提问,获取更多电子资料。

6.6K20

正则表达式来了,Excel的正则表达式匹配示例

在单元格查找特定字符串时,FIND函数和SEARCH函数非常方便。如何知道单元格是否包含给定模式匹配的信息?显然,可以使用正则表达式。...用于匹配字符串Excel VBA正则表达式函数 要在Excel中使用正则表达式,需要创建自己的函数。...Exit Function ErrHandl: RegExpMatch = CVErr(xlErrValue) End Function RegExpMatch语法 RegExpMatch函数检查字符串的任何部分是否正则表达式匹配...\b字符表示单词边界,意味着SKU是单独的单词,而不是较大字符串(如23-MAR-2022)的一部分。 建立了模式后,可以继续编写公式。实质上,使用自定义函数内置函数没有什么不同。...lemons)向右查找,看前面是否没有单词“lemons”。如果没有“lemons”,则该点除换行符以外的任何字符匹配

20K30

正则表达式太慢?这里有一个提速100倍的方案(附代码)

这份列表将用于在内部建立一个单词查找树的字典(Trie dictionary)。然后你将一个字符串传递给它,并告诉它是要执行替换还是搜索。 对于替换,它将用替换关键字创建一个新字符串。...如果我们从语料库拿出每个单词,并且检查是否出现在句子,这需要我们遍历字符串四次。 如果语料库里有n个词,它将需要n个循环。并且每个搜索步骤(is in sentence?)...将花费自己的时间,这就是正则匹配(Regex match)的机制。 还有第一种方法相反的另一种方法L对于句子的每个单词检查是否存在于语料库。 如果这个句子有m个词,它就有m个循环。...关键字只有在它的两边有单词边界时才能被匹配。这样可以防止apple和pineapple的匹配。 接下来,我们将输入一个字符串I like Python,并且一个字符一个字符搜索他、它。...FlashText算法只检查输入字符串“I like Python”的每个字符。即便我们的字典有一百万个关键字,这对它的运行几乎没有影响。这正是FlashText算法的能力所在。

2.4K40

双数组Trie树AC自动机简要总结

使用两个数组 base 和 check 来维护 Trie 树,base 负责记录状态,check 负责检查各个字符串是否是从同一个状态转移而来,当 check[i]为负值时,表示此状态为字符串的结束。...对于每个关键字,都会进行查找以查看其发生位置。当寻找几个关键字时,这种方法很棒,但是当搜索 100,000 个单词时,这种方法非常慢(例如,检索字典)。...但是,如果没有匹配状态,该算法将发出失败信号(fail 表), 并退回到深度较小的状态(即匹配时间较短),然后从那里继续进行,直到找到匹配状态或达到根状态为止。...只要达到整个关键字匹配的状态,就会将其发送到输出集(output 表),在整个扫描完成后可以读取该输出集。 该算法为 O(n)。不管给出多少个关键字,或者搜索文本有多大,性能都会线性下降。...Aho-Corasick 算法可以帮助: 在文本中找到要链接到或重点强调的单词; 在纯文本添加语义; 检查字典以查看是否存在语法错误。

3.3K20

​如何在Linux中使用grep命令?

这个命令对于Linux操作系统的日常任务非常有用。 grep命令可以搜索给定文本匹配的行,以便在您使用命令提及的给定文件内查找。...实际上,当我们在整个文件系统搜索关键字时,上面的选项(-l)非常有用。 在简要讨论-l选项之前,我先介绍另一个选项。 选项4:使用-R递归搜索关键字 ?...选项7:使用-w搜索确切的关键字 认为您正在搜索一个名为boo的单词。猜猜我们有一个名为example.txt的文件。在该文件内部,它的行boo完全相同。...重要提示–我们不仅可以使用grep命令搜索文件字符串模式,还可以从不同的命令输出过滤特定的字符串模式。 1)显示所有磁盘详细信息 ? 2)检查syslog文件的错误 ?...3)从包列表结果获取mysql-server包 ? 4)检查正在运行的特定服务的进程 猜猜您需要检查已迁移的进程是否正在运行。无论您需要检查什么服务。

3K41

【编译原理】词法分析:CC++实现

数组存储了一些关键字用于词法分析程序判断标识符是否关键字,包括 "main", "int", "if", "else", "for", "while", "do", "return", "break...,词法分析程序可以在处理标识符时,将其这些关键字进行比较,以确定标识符是否关键字。...如果标识符数组的任何一个关键字匹配,那么该标识符将被识别为关键字,否则将被视为普通的标识符。...6.检查当前字符是否属于关系运算符,包括等于、不等于、小于、大于等。 7.如果是关系运算符,读取下一个字符,并检查是否当前字符形成双字符的关系运算符(如小于等于、大于等于)。...循环结束后,会得到一个识别到的算术运算符存储在 calcu 数组。 3.接下来,进行注释检查的逻辑。声明一个整型变量 flag 并初始化为 true,用于标识是否是注释。

84610

看动画轻松理解「Trie树」

o,发现 o 节点下方不存在子节点 o,则创建子节点 o 插入第三个字母 k,发现 o 节点下方不存在子节点 k,则创建子节点 k 至此,单词 cook 中所有字母已被插入 Trie树 然后设置节点...cod的匹配路径 程序员不要当一条咸鱼,要向 cook 靠拢:) Trie树的删除操作 Trie树的删除操作二叉树的删除操作有类似的地方,需要考虑删除的节点所处的位置,这里分三种情况进行分析: 删除整个单词...我们只需要用所有字符串构造一个 trie树,然后输出以 五−>分−>钟 开头的路径上的关键字即可。 trie树前缀匹配用于搜索提示。如当输入一个网址,可以自动搜索出可能的选择。...给定一组字符串,查找某个字符串是否出现过,思路就是从根节点开始一个一个字符进行比较: 如果沿路比较,发现不同的字符,则表示该字符串在集合存在。...如果所有的字符全部比较完并且全部相同,还需判断最后一个节点的标志位(标记该节点是否代表一个关键字)。

1.1K20

面试必备:接口自动化测试精选面试干货

/必选,考虑参数有互斥或关联的情况)和出参数据(符合接口文档需求)以及明确的格式和检查点; 第三步:开发一起对接口测试用例进行评审; 第四步:结合开发库,准备接口测试用例的入参数据和出参数据,并整理成...数据长度不一致,例如设计很长的字符串是否支持,因为数据库创建表过程都设置好了每个字段的长度。输入错误的参数和数据,如故意输错单词等等。...数据库匹配核对:比如对查询一个接口返回的数据进行验证时,可通过编写sql语句查询结果,然后将sql语句执行后数据库返回的结果与接口返回的结果进行核对,以此来判定测试用例是否执行成功; 5)通过相关接口进行辅助验证...API测试语言无关。 API测试在测试核心功能方面非常有用。我们可以在没有用户界面的情况下测试API。在GUI测试,我们需要等到应用程序可用于测试核心功能。 API测试有助于我们降低风险。...,可以找研发确认,或者自己登录到服务器上,通过ps命令检查项目的进程是否存在然后用tail命令查看部署日志; 4.检查服务器防火墙是否关闭,如果因为安全或者权限问题不能关闭,需要找运维进行策略配置,开放对应的

81740

SQL反模式学习笔记17 全文搜索

目标:全文搜索 使用SQL搜索关键字,同时保证快速和精确,依旧是相当地困难。 SQL的一个基本原理(以及SQL所继承的关系原理)就是一列的单个数据是原子性的。...2、如何写一个正则表达式来检查一个字符串是否包含多个单词、不包含一个特定的单词,或者包含给定单词的任意形式?   3、网站的搜索功能在增加了很多文档进去之后慢的不可理喻。...合理使用反模式:   1、性能总是最重要的,如果一些查询过程很少执行,就不必要花很多功夫去对它进行优化   2、使用模式匹配操作进行很复杂的查询是很困难的,但是如果你为了一些简单的需求设计这样的模式匹配...另一个方案是将结果保存起来从而减少重复的搜索开销。   1、MySQL的全文索引:可以再一个类型为Char、varchar或者Text的列上定义一个全文索引。然后使用Match函数来搜索。   ...(1)定义一个KeyWords表来记录所有用户搜索的关键字然后定义一个交叉表来建立多对多的关系。     (2)将每个关键字匹配的内容添加到交叉表

1.2K10

SHELL编程基本知识点一

/usr/awk -f 2,条件表达式 条件表达式用于 [[ 复合命令以及内建命令 test 和 [ ,用来测试文件属性,进行字符串和算术比较。...* 万能匹配字符,用于文件名匹配(这个东西有个专有名词叫 file globbing),或者是正则 表达式.注意:在正则表达式匹配的作用和在文件名匹配的作用是不同的....2、检查命令行的第一个令牌是否为不带引号或反斜杠的关键字,如果此令牌是开放关键字,开放关键字指if、while、for或其他控制结构的开始符号,Shell就认为此命令是复合命令,并为该复合命令进行内部设置...3、检查命令行的第一个令牌是否为某命令的别名,这需要将此令牌别名(alia)列表逐个比较,如果匹配,说明该令牌是别名,则将该令牌替换掉,返回步骤1,否则进入步骤4。...8、将$((string))的表达式进行算术运算。 9、从变量、命令和算术替换的结果取出命令行,再次进行单词切分,步骤1不同的是,此时不再用元字符分隔单词,而是使用$IFS分隔单词

91920

接口自动化面试题放送,助你离Offer又近一步!

/必选,考虑参数有互斥或关联的情况)和出参数据(符合接口文档需求)以及明确的格式和检查点; 第三步:开发一起对接口测试用例进行评审; 第四步:结合开发库,准备接口测试用例的入参数据和出参数据,并整理成...数据长度不一致,例如设计很长的字符串是否支持,因为数据库创建表过程都设置好了每个字段的长度。输入错误的参数和数据,如故意输错单词等等。...1)响应码:检查响应码是否符合预期,用来判断测试用例是否执行成功(针对http接口); 2)关键字:验证关键字是否符合预期,用来判断测试用例是否执行成功; 3)正则匹配:当一个接口返回的内容较多,并且有一定规律时...,可通过正则表达式来校验接口返回的信息来判定测试用例是否执行成功; 4)数据库匹配核对:比如对查询一个接口返回的数据进行验证时,可通过编写sql语句查询结果,然后将sql语句执行后数据库返回的结果与接口返回的结果进行核对...API测试语言无关。 API测试在测试核心功能方面非常有用。我们可以在没有用户界面的情况下测试API。在GUI测试,我们需要等到应用程序可用于测试核心功能。 API测试有助于我们降低风险。

57030

Excel公式练习34: 识别是否存在相同字母的单词

本次的练习是:判断单元格区域B1:B10的各单元格单词是否在单元格区域E1:E10出现,如果该单词出现或者存在单词相同字母组成的单词,则返回TRUE,否则返回FALSE。...: LEN($E$1:$E$10)=LEN(B3) 检查单元格区域E1:E10有哪些单词单元格B3单词的字符数相同,得到数组: {TRUE;FALSE;TRUE;TRUE;FALSE;TRUE;TRUE...下一个要考虑的字符串,是单元格E2字符串(“adel”),只有四个字符的长度,不会超过我们公式的初始部分(该部分检查字符串是否B3的长度相同)。...至此,我们已经在E1:E10找到了组成单元格B3字符串字母相同的字符串,但如何让Excel知道呢?...将上面得到的数组设置为等于单元格B3字符串的长度(6),然后将得到的TRUE/FALSE组成的数组检查字符串长度得到的数组相乘: =OR((LEN($E$1:$E$10)=LEN(B3))*(MMULT

1.2K10

为什么数据结构算法对前端开发很重要

Trie树的插入操作 Trie树的插入操作很简单,其实就是将单词的每个字母逐一插入 Trie树。插入前先看字母对应的节点是否存在存在则共享该节点,不存在则创建对应的节点。...o,发现 o 节点下方不存在子节点 o,则创建子节点 o 插入第三个字母 k,发现 o 节点下方不存在子节点 k,则创建子节点 k 至此,单词 cook 中所有字母已被插入 Trie树 然后设置节点...cod的匹配路径 Trie树的删除操作 Trie树的删除操作二叉树的删除操作有类似的地方,需要考虑删除的节点所处的位置,这里分三种情况进行分析: 删除整个单词(比如 hi ) ?...我们只需要用所有字符串构造一个 trie树,然后输出以 五−>分−>钟 开头的路径上的关键字即可。 trie树前缀匹配用于搜索提示。如当输入一个网址,可以自动搜索出可能的选择。...给定一组字符串,查找某个字符串是否出现过,思路就是从根节点开始一个一个字符进行比较: 如果沿路比较,发现不同的字符,则表示该字符串在集合存在

60610

Pandas 2.2 中文官方教程和指南(四)

DataFrame 的列另一个 DataFrame 的索引进行连接时。...(注意也可以通过公式来实现。) 在 pandas 中提取单词的最简单方法是通过空格拆分字符串然后按索引引用单词。注意,如果需要的话,还有更强大的方法。...(注意,也可以通过公式进行操作。) 在 pandas 中提取单词的最简单方法是通过空格拆分字符串然后按索引引用单词。请注意,如果需要,还有更强大的方法。...电子表格有一个MID公式用于从给定位置提取子字符串。...(注意,也可以通过公式实现。) 在 pandas 中提取单词的最简单方法是通过空格拆分字符串然后按索引引用单词。请注意,如果需要,还有更强大的方法。

23410

数据分析常用的Excel函数

vlookup简介 四种查询方式 1.单条件查找 根据工号,将左边检索区域的“电脑销售额”匹配到右边对应位置,只需要使用VLOOKUP函数,结果存在则显示对应的“电脑销售额”;结果不存在则显示#N/A。...反向查找 反向查找的固定公式用法: =VLOOKUP(检索关键字,IF({1,0},检索关键字所在列,查找值所在列),2,0) 注意:其实反向查找除了检索区域改成一个虚拟数组公式IF之外,其他和单条件查找没有区别...HLOOKUP =HLOOKUP(用谁去找, 匹配对象范围, 返回第几行, 匹配方式) 和VLOOKUP的区别:HLOOKUP返回的值查找的值在同一列上,而VLOOKUP返回的值查找的值在同一行上。...HYPERLINK HYPERLINK:创建一个超链接指向link_location,以friendly_name的字符串进行显示,link_location可以是URL链接或文件路径。...插入超链接 逻辑运算函数 一般用于条件运算,在Excel,True代表数值1,False代表0。 IF 如果满足判断条件,则返回“真值”,否则返回“假值”。

4.1K21

Trie树的原理及应用

在计算机科学,trie,又称前缀树或字典树,是一种有序树,用于保存关联数组,其中的键通常是字符串二叉查找树不同,键不是直接保存在节点中,而是由节点在树的位置决定。...通常在实现的时候,会在节点结构设置一个标志,用来标记该结点处是否构成一个单词关键字), 或者存储一些其他相关的值。...可以看出,Trie 树的关键字一般都是字符串,而且 Trie 树把每个关键字存在一条路径上,而不是一个结点中。...词频统计 我们可以修改 Trie 树的实现,将每个节点的 是否在此构成单词标志位改成此处构成的单词数量. 这样我们可以用它进行搜索场景常见的词频统计。 当然这个需求 hash 表也是可以实现的。...前缀匹配 例如:找出一个字符串集合中所有以 ab 开头的字符串。我们只需要用所有字符串构造一个 trie 树,然后输出以$a->b->$开头的路径上的关键字即可。 trie 树前缀匹配用于搜索提示。

1K30
领券